With its distinctive Leinenkugel's roof dormers, Village Liquor Store is conveniently located just a stone's throw away from downtown Hudson in North Hudson. The store is brightly and attractively lit, with well-organized shelves and a wide selection of liquor and liquor-related items. In addition to alcohol, customers can also pick up ice, snacks, or even a cigar near the register.